Merge branch 'fixes' into for-linus
[firefly-linux-kernel-4.4.55.git] / include / linux / netdev_features.h
index 77f5202977ceb6ced9785142189bd2d5e702539e..5ac32123035a5159c7c017a3ac29aec8ee9291af 100644 (file)
@@ -54,6 +54,8 @@ enum {
        NETIF_F_RXCSUM_BIT,             /* Receive checksumming offload */
        NETIF_F_NOCACHE_COPY_BIT,       /* Use no-cache copyfromuser */
        NETIF_F_LOOPBACK_BIT,           /* Enable loopback */
+       NETIF_F_RXFCS_BIT,              /* Append FCS to skb pkt data */
+       NETIF_F_RXALL_BIT,              /* Receive errored frames too */
 
        /*
         * Add your fresh new feature above and remember to update
@@ -98,6 +100,8 @@ enum {
 #define NETIF_F_TSO            __NETIF_F(TSO)
 #define NETIF_F_UFO            __NETIF_F(UFO)
 #define NETIF_F_VLAN_CHALLENGED        __NETIF_F(VLAN_CHALLENGED)
+#define NETIF_F_RXFCS          __NETIF_F(RXFCS)
+#define NETIF_F_RXALL          __NETIF_F(RXALL)
 
 /* Features valid for ethtool to change */
 /* = all defined minus driver/device-class-related */